Capybara's Commute

This gentle grazer was lounging in the lake when hunger struck, prompting it to swim to shore.

One bridge? No problem.

The capy slipped underwater as it reached the park’s elevated walkway, then resurfaced on the other side.

Back on terra firma, it was time to eat.

I’ve always been a big fan of Ray Harryhausen and his incredible work on films like Jason and the Argonauts. That brings me to today’s fun fact: names that sound modern but are actually ancient.

Here are three:

  • Jason — from Greek mythology, specifically Jason, leader of the Argonauts in search of the Golden Fleece.

  • Chloe — an ancient Greek name meaning “young green shoot.”

  • Zoe — another ancient Greek name, meaning “life.”
